Atenolol is a medication that belongs to a class of drugs known as beta-blockers. It is primarily used to treat various cardiovascular conditions, including high blood pressure and angina. By blocking the effects of adrenaline on the heart, atenolol reduces heart rate and blood pressure, making it easier for the heart to pump blood. This can lead to a decrease in the risk of heart attacks and other serious complications associated with heart disease. The mechanism of action of atenolol is quite fascinating. When the body experiences stress or excitement, adrenaline levels rise, causing the heart to beat faster and with more force. For individuals with hypertension or heart disease, this can be detrimental. atenolol, by inhibiting the action of adrenaline, helps to calm the heart and maintain a more stable rhythm. This property makes it particularly useful for patients who have experienced heart-related issues in the past.In addition to its primary uses, atenolol is also prescribed for other conditions such as anxiety and migraine prevention. Some studies suggest that beta-blockers can help manage the physical symptoms of anxiety, such as rapid heartbeat and trembling. Similarly, by stabilizing blood flow and reducing vascular tension, atenolol can help prevent the onset of migraines in some individuals.However, like any medication, atenolol comes with potential side effects. Common side effects include fatigue, cold hands and feet, and dizziness. In some cases, patients may experience more severe reactions, such as difficulty breathing or swelling of the face and throat. It is crucial for patients to communicate openly with their healthcare providers about any adverse effects they experience while taking atenolol.Patients should also be aware of the importance of adhering to their prescribed dosage. Stopping atenolol suddenly can lead to serious complications, including a rebound increase in blood pressure or heart rate. Therefore, it is essential to follow a doctor’s guidance regarding the discontinuation of the medication.Lifestyle changes often accompany the prescription of atenolol. Doctors typically recommend a balanced diet, regular exercise, and stress management techniques to enhance the effectiveness of the medication. These lifestyle modifications can significantly improve overall heart health and reduce the reliance on medications over time.In conclusion, atenolol is a valuable tool in the management of cardiovascular diseases and other related conditions. Its ability to lower heart rate and blood pressure has made it a staple in many treatment regimens. However, understanding its effects, potential side effects, and the importance of lifestyle changes is crucial for anyone prescribed this medication. As with any health-related issue, patients should work closely with their healthcare providers to ensure the best possible outcomes when using atenolol for their health needs.
